Research Abstract

Murota and Fukuhara investigated the examples of breakages of hydraulic structures around rapid stream rivers in the Hokuriku district. In addition, to examine the mechanism of their damage, they carried out laboratory experiments using open channels with simple and compound cross-sections and clarified the effects of dynamic fluid force on the breaks of spur dikes and flood planes.
To give the directions of operation of tide gates when typhoons strike, Hashino estimated the concurrent characteristics of both heavy rainfalls and large storm surges associated with typhoons through the rainfall-storm surge simulation with a stochastic typhoon model and proposed a stochastic formula of design storm pattern.
Kanda carried out a field survey to measure turbulence properties of velocity fluctuation using a ultrasonic flowmeter in rivers in Hyogo Prefecture and investigated the mechanism of erosion at the toe of the concrete revetment.
Sato constructed a defurmable rock block model and applied the model to groundwater motion around dam basements and rock slopes in order to examine the effects of its motion on the stability of the structures laid around rivers.
